Overview

Situated approximately 10 minutes by car from Sackville College, the 3-star The Swan At Forest Row hotel features Wi-Fi throughout the property, and a car park on site.

Location

The Parish Church of the Holy Trinity is located a mere 6 minutes' walk from the inn, and such natural sites as Weir Wood Reservoir are nearly 25 minutes' walk away. Worthing is 43 km from the property, while Royal Ashdown Forest Golf Club is merely an 11-minute walk away. This Forest Row hotel also takes you to The Llama Park, which is about a 10-minute ride away.

There is Brambletye bus stop approximately a 5-minute walk away.

Rooms

The Swan At Forest Row hotel features 6 rooms with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, as well as tea and coffee making facilities. Nice touches include a separate toilet and a shower, along with a hairdryer and towels.

Eat & Drink

Guests can have breakfast in the restaurant. Two Two One Restaurant is located next to the hotel and serves British dishes, about a 5-minute walk away.
